Goodspeed To Require Vaccination, Masks For Audience

The theater will hold indoor musical performances and require audience members to show proof of vaccination and wear a mask.

(Autumn Johnson/Patch)

EAST HADDAM, CT — Goodspeed Musicals will still hold its fall performances and will require audience members to show proof of vaccination and wear a mask, according to The Hartford Business Journal. Sept. 24 marks the start of a two-month run of "A Grand Night for Singing: In Celebration of Rodgers & Hammerstein."

Goodspeed has previously run concerts and programs in an outdoor space. The new COVID-19 protocols for indoor performances are expected to be in place at least until the end of the year.
